It's been a while since I last wrote!So many transformation happened, so many things I've learned...
I started opening up after a break up with a boyfriend I had!
It made me get closer to myself, and really look at wrong things I was telling myself abut... ME! I was putting me down, and seeing me as much less that I trully am... Therefore... I attracted someone who would just reinforce this belief I had.
So much I learned in this process... But specially , I learned to love exactly who I am. I figured out that all have been hidding my true self for years, because somehow I learned bad labels about those traits.
I have always been a person who wanted to come from the heart, but I was TOTALLY SCARED about doing it. I easily sense when people are wearing a mask while communicating.It's not their fault.. Somehow we are taught that the most beautiful part of us which is giving and receiving love is... HARMFUL!. It might sound crazy, but yes, this crazy belief is out there all the time. There is this crazy idea that showing love is a synonym of weakness, and this is why people normally wear masks... Honestly, what I found o
ut is that we all are CRAZY about hugging someone, giving/receiving love, making connections, speaking from the heart and with the heart of others. BUT we cover this need of us, and even label it as something ridiculous, being "too needy", weakness... The people who behave as if they didn't care about it are those who are seen as strong. They are seen as positive. Then we buy the idea, and even convince ourselves that we are weaks if we show those kind of affection.
In practice, this is very wrong. Human connection can only exist where there is real feelings happening. Where there is comprehension, affection and the expressions of love there.
It is not silly: We are very capable of loving people - if we allow us to do it.
What happens when we don't accept this human vulnerability in us, and let our ego tell us that we should NEEEVER be in touch with it because this is weakness, is that we will attract a person that has the same buffer around their hearts.
Be them friends or valentines, or whatever... because our subconscious mind will search to what feels safe to it: so if it is not trained to be comfortable being vulnerable to LOVE, it will feel scared of opening up,and consider to be "weird" those people who like doing it.
As long as we don't change this automatic belief, we might consciously think that we want to have a boyfriend, but unconsciously feel like being loved and loving is waaay to vulnerable and unsafe.
So... I am happy that my deep desire of loving and being loved was always right, and even more happy to know that those beliefs that were telling me that this deep desire was too scary... were just silly beliefs.
I wish from my heart that my ex can open up to himself and look close to what he needs to remove in order to be comfortable being vulnerable to love. I send him love and compassion. He really needs it, and to all the people in his situation - the one I also was before... A condition of blocking love, of hiding from it with every possible excuse ! A condition of thinking "Oh, I can not show my feelingS!" OR "Oh...Im happy alone. relationships will always fail" or even "I am focused in my carreer.. there is no space for someone" or "I am ashamed of showing some parts of mine... until I have them solved, no one will ever love me." or "I am afraid of getting hurt"
Well... ever excuse is there when we don't trully believe love is possible. When two people change those beliefs, they are no longer driven by them and will just relax and smile to welcome this beautiful person that is meant to be their soulmate!
